laylow,
Let me put my two cents in the pot. I had the same problem after I got my 300 out of the body shop. The button between the gas filler door release and the trunk button release had gotten pushed in , not locked while there at the body shop. I was flustered and felt that the mechanism had failed and then I purchased another one off of e bay and then I found the button pushed in. DUMB Best of luck.

Hey Laylow,
Here is what I found and didn't find :
The unit I was talking about is not a serviceable item, (Switch Assembly, Luggage Door Opening which has the two switches for the trunk and gas filler with the two switches on the back side) My '92 - '93 Parts Book does list this assembly in three different colors.
I would be searching the junk yards if it was me.

UPDATE>>> if you locked your only key in the trunk and someone pushed the lock cylinder on the dash so the trunk popper is "locked" you can pop the panel that houses the popper switches and remove the metal band around the base of the lock cylinder, Its a spring steel C shaped band of metal. just pull it back off the cylinder and then youll see 2 little black buttons, press one with a small screwdriver and the lock will release, pop out and the switch will now pop the trunk again if the circuit is good. This saved me from getting into the trunk via the subwoofer to hook my keys. This took all but 5 minutes and 4 screws.
